昨晚上,我们一个同事组织了一个小会议,大家一起讨论了一个项目的单片机代码,这个单片机用的是单片机,期间大家也讨论了一些问题,总结一下,希望对写单片机的同学们有帮助。我这个同事写的代码...
原创 2021-07-30 14:21:18
239阅读
嵌入式Linux 2月20日最近在搞单片机,所以记录下这部分内容。之前的相关文章呵,你会51单片机的精确延时吗?嵌入式Linux一个有温度的技术公众号435篇原创内容公众号假如使用者想要产生精确的延迟时间,建议使用 __nop() 函数来组合达成。__nop() 函数能够产生 1 个精确的 CPU 频率周期延迟时间。然而,由于 flash 的速度低于 CPU 的频率速度,在 CPU 内部有快取
转载 2021-03-20 13:15:29
140阅读
最近在搞单片机,所以记录下这部分内容。之前的相关文章呵,你会51单片机的精确延时吗?假如使用者想要产生精确的延迟时间,建议使用 __nop() 函数来组合达成。__nop() 函数能够...
转载 2021-07-30 11:02:37
425阅读
目录1.前言2.windows  串口通信API3.JAVA-JNI  java程序调用C++程序4.C/C++封装  动态运行库一、前言 Application Programming Interface,应用程序接口 )。java在安装了相关的包后,比如JNative.jar,可以直接用该包提供的接口来进行调用windowsAPI。但是我才接触java。而且整个作业,我仅仅只要一部分来处理这个
转载 2023-08-09 11:44:03
285阅读
刚开始学习51单片机的时候,我是看郭天祥老师和开发板,现在我依然觉得非常适合零基础入门。单片机入门到高级开挂学习路径(附教程+工具)大家的起点都一样,不懂电路,不懂C语言,不懂单片机,或许有的人起点比我高很多,有类似电路和编程的基础,这种情况学习的话会更容易。在学习单片机的过程中,我认为教程不是最关键的,因为技术已经很成熟了,各家大同小异。记得我学习的时候,经常会碰到的问题就是视频教程看懂了,然后
在当今快速发展的科技领域中,单片机Linux操作系统是两个备受关注的关键词。单片机是指在一个芯片上集成了微处理器、存储器和其他必要的外设的小型电子计算机系统,而Linux则是一种开源的操作系统,被广泛应用于各种计算设备中。本文将探讨单片机Linux的关联,并探索其在各个领域的应用。 单片机Linux操作系统在不同的领域发挥着重要的作用。单片机作为一种嵌入式系统,被广泛应用于家电、汽车、医疗
原创 2024-02-05 15:30:08
110阅读
有些人说Linux下怎么开发单片机程序? 我们学得都是在Windows下的开发工具和烧录工具。其实这只是中国的情况,中国大都是用Windows系统的。所以我们也只接触到Windows下的开发工具。在国外,许多大牛是不用Windows的。那么,他们如果要做单片机怎么办?肯定没问题的,Linux也有许多的单片机和嵌入式的开发工具。下面,我以51系列单片机为例,介绍一下怎么使用Linux系统玩单片机。&
STC15系列单片机教程之一:OneLEDSTC15系列单片机教程之一:OneLED一、开发软件准备二、STC15F2K60S单片机IO分配三、程序编写1.Keil 新建项目2.编写程序3. 程序的编译四、固件下载总结本系列教程开始学习STC15系列单片机的C语言编程,读者需要有C语言的基础知识。 一、开发软件准备1. 安装编程软件:Keil 2. 下载软件STC_Isp 3. 配置keil下
      这次给大家介绍的是一个温湿度,光照烟雾等监测设计,包含开关灯。基于STM32F103单片机(正点原子mini板)、蓝牙模块、Android APP完成。软件是Android studio 2021.1版,首先先展示一下设计好的实物。 接下来将从硬件、软件两个部分来阐述。1. 硬件部分程序中用变量代替,利于移植)、蓝牙串口模块HC05和Androi
转载 2023-10-27 18:59:37
182阅读
串口屏Modbus协议,串口屏的modbus协议资料,串口屏modbus通讯协议开发,串口屏之modbus协议使用技巧     本例程中用51单片机作为Modbus从,从的设备地址为2,从有4个寄存器,寄存器地址分别为3,4,5,6,协议类型为保持寄存器,功能码为03和06。    第一步:新建一个工程
.软件解密,但的精元脚位等比较特殊,不支持软解,软解把握的成功率不高 2.开片入侵型解密,运用设备开片进行精元图脚位连接加密部分,用我们自主专属开发的编程器进行读取,但读出来的还是乱码,必须一步一步的进行纠正以及还原
近年来,随着信息技术的迅猛发展,Linux操作系统(以下简称 Linux)作为一种开源操作系统,在嵌入式系统中的应用越来越广泛。而与Linux相对应的单片机,也称为微控制器,是一种集成了处理器、存储器和外设接口的芯片,广泛应用于嵌入式系统中。本文将重点探讨Linux单片机的相关性,以及它们在嵌入式系统中的应用。 首先,我们来了解一下Linux操作系统。Linux是一种免费且开放源代码的操作系统
原创 2024-02-02 11:27:59
236阅读
EtherCat概述博客是本人开发支持EtherCat通信电机驱动器的笔记,所以基本上是从从站设计的角度来的,主站内容大多只是提一下用作了解,详细的还是需要查阅书籍。以太网基础:系统组成这里不多说,很多资料都有,ecat能各种串,每个从站截取自己的数据然后把自己发送的数据发到对应的位置。EtherCAt主站组成:主站使用标准以太网控制器没有什么特殊区别,在基于PC的主站中使用网卡NIC(Netwo
单片机控制GSM手机的技术及应用随着科技的飞速发展和人民生活水平的不断提高,手机的普及率越来越高,更新也越来越快,价格也越来越便宜。   因为手机工作的无线网络覆盖范围广,在信息传递方面性能稳定、可靠,所以把手机作为信息传递的载体,与单片机结合起来构成应用系统有着强大的生命力和广阔的应用空间,特别是在远程数据传输、远程监控等领域更是受到电子设计应用工程师的关注。一些专业刊物也介绍了
转载 2023-07-20 23:46:25
294阅读
前言单片机入门什么是单片机封装单片机工作的基本时序数字电路基础二进制逻辑运算80C51的引脚建立keil工程文件LED开发板LED原理图点亮LEDLED闪烁LED流水灯静态数码管原理图封装工作原理静态数码管控制独立按键封装原理图独立按键编程实例:点亮流水灯下面我们开始本节课的内容单片机入门什么是单片机单片机是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器(CPU),随机
原创 精选 2022-05-17 20:07:00
3775阅读
2点赞
0 引言       SNMP(简单网络管理协议)应用广泛,功能强大,只要管理软件驻留有MIB(管理信息库),并且拥有适当的权限,管理器就可以访问SNMP代理器。SNMP一般用于计算机网络和电信网络,本文提出了用SNMP进行控制。由于其传输媒介是Internet,所以传输距离不受限制,这相对于其他工业控制总线有不可比拟的优势,SNMP最大的优点是协议简洁,
转载 2024-07-31 20:20:06
126阅读
直入主题:硬件部分:l298n、单片机最小系统(最优选,因为有很多外设的板子会影响输出电压大小,导致输出电压不够)、12V直流电源、HC-05蓝牙模块、USB转TTl模块、小车底盘一个(带电机的)、杜邦线若干。     下图为HC-05蓝牙模块,此模块有6引脚。          下图为USB转 T
今天那书看了下,做在那5个小时,只看了两个小时书,可能是还进入状态吧,看一下就看不进去了,老是想别的事,但我还是坚持做在那,没有去上网,我想刚开始我能克服这点,心就能静很多了,接下来就是好好看吧,我要给自己鼓励下,坚持哦,加油          加油     ,你一定行
原创 2007-07-15 22:31:32
1127阅读
1评论
单片机 ADC0834转换程序 89c51 ;****************************** ;** 通道转换程序段 ******* ;**100单端通道0 101通道2 ***** ;**110通道1     111通道3 ***** ;**000差分 通道0+ 1-     ***** ;****************************** ;****************************** ;** AD转换子程序   **** ;****************************** ADC:   MOV A,TDC     ;工作方式设定     CLR CS   ;选通     MOV R7,#04H ADC1:   CLR CLK     RLC A     MOV DI,C    
原创 2011-04-28 21:23:41
899阅读
原创 3月前
48阅读
  • 1
  • 2
  • 3
  • 4
  • 5